Short answer
It depends on its condition. A slightly dried-out segment is usually fine, but if it was mouldy or fermented, it could cause an upset stomach. Watch for vomiting, diarrhea, or loss of appetite over the next day. Offer your dog some water and call your vet if you see any of those signs.
